Review: Coldbrook by Tim Lebbon

Coldbrook is a new horror novel from bestselling author Tim Lebbon. The story revolves around a secret facility deep in the Appalachian Mountains – named after the eponymous and deceased genius Bill Coldbrook – where a small team of scientists have achieved the impossible: breaking through from Earth into a parallel reality.
